Description

Stor-Kunnan Nature Reserve is located about 3 kilometres west of Möja and includes most of Stor-Kunnan along with nearby islands and skerries.

These islands feature typical mid-archipelago nature, with easy walking terrain and partly pine-covered rocky outcrops. The shores are mainly rocky, and in places—especially on Stora and Lilla Kunnören—they are flat and very attractive for swimming.

There are no recreational facilities in the reserve, apart from informational signs.

Facts

Protected since: 1975

Area: 31 hectares
Character: Archipelago, coniferous forest

Municipality: Värmdö

Land ownership: Private

Managing authority: Stockholm County Administrative Board

Protection status: Nature reserve

Regulations

To protect Stor-Kunnan Nature Reserve, there are rules you must follow.

Within the reserve, it is prohibited to:

  • damage or destroy natural features
  • break branches, cut down, or otherwise harm living or dead trees and bushes, or dig up plants, mosses, or lichens
  • dig up flowers or damage ground vegetation
  • deliberately disturb wildlife
  • allow dogs off leash
  • camp for more than two nights
  • anchor a boat in the same place for more than two days
  • light fires
  • use musical instruments, sound systems, or similar equipment in a disruptive manner
